Why Does Hisense TV Turns on By Itself Mysteriously
- This issue may arise if your TV isn’t working on the latest updated firmware version.
- The power button on the remote control may be stuck
- Timer settings on your TV could trigger this problem
- Your Tv isn’t obtaining a significant power supply
What to Do if Your Hisense TV Keeps Turning On and Off
If your Hisense TV keeps turning on and off by itself, below are clear solutions to solve this annoying problem once and for all.
1. Check your remote control
Take a closer look at the remote control buttons. You can inspect if any of the buttons are stuck or if some are not responding even when the batteries are okay. When there is a problem with the remote, it’s time to consider replacing it with a new one. You can find one online for less than 10 dollars.
Moreover, there is another alternative and easy way you can do to replace your remote through a smartphone. The process is straightforward as the only thing required is by downloading Hisense remote now app on Google Play Store or App Store.
2. Evaluation of TV Power Connection
When your Tv isn’t getting a constant power supply, it most likely causes the device to turn on and off by itself. The first thing to do to solve the problem is to make sure that the power adapter is firmly in place. Alternatively, you can connect it to another Power supply outlet and observe what happens.
If that doesn’t work, it’s time to purchase a Power code online to solve the problem. However, it’s always advisable to first confirm which type of power code is required before purchasing.
3. Inspect For Any Firmware Updates
Firmware lets Tv’s hardware and software to correspond and work together. Failure to update to the latest and current firmware update could sometimes lead to the device malfunctioning. Below are 5 steps you need to follow to check for firmware problems and update to the latest version.
1. Turn on the Hisense Tv
2. On the remote control press the gear button
3. Select “all”
4. ‘Click system update’
5. Tap (Detect)
Remember that you may be required to keenly follow prompts on the screen which is not limited to providing your Wifi credentials.
4. Toggle your Hisence timer settings
For any reason, your Hisense tv could be turning on or off due to timer settings set up sometimes unknowingly. Time to adjust the set time to stop this issue. Follow these steps to adjust your tv timer settings below.
1. First power on the tv
2. Press the gear button on the Tv’s remote control
3. Select ‘system’
4. Choose ‘timer settings
5. Adjust ‘Sleep timer to off
